Rip PS3 Games on your PS3
According to an article on Ehomeupgrade, ripping Hi Def Blu-Ray movies and PS3 games is as simple as typing a line of code into the ‘terminal’ of the Playstation 3. Apparently, this requires the PS3 to be loaded with a Linux OS and can actually be done on any computer running Linux with a Blu-Ray drive - its just ironic that you can already rip PS3 games on the system.

  3. Fraz says:

    Like Zaki points out, this isn’t a hack at all. Nothing prevents computers from reading the ROM, but all the files are encrypted and without the keys to decrypt those files copying the cipher text is useless. You can do it with a “cp” or “copy” command, but so what!?
